Wolf came away from his most recent start against the A's with one of his specialties, a no-decision. He has 10 of them, only eight shy of the Los Angeles Dodgers record set by Odalis Perez in 2004. Wolf checked in with another quality start, allowing one run in six innings, while stranding five runners in scoring position. The Dodgers have won seven of his past eight starts.

Floyd has really come on strong of late, producing his sixth consecutive quality start on Thursday against the Cubs. He has allowed one earned run in each of his last three starts and carries a 1.58 ERA in his last six. During that span, Floyd has lowered his ERA from 7.71 to 4.65. In his career against the Dodgers, Floyd has struggled. In three starts, he carries a 10.50 ERA. He has thrown 12 innings, allowing 19 hits, 17 runs -- 14 earned -- with seven strikeouts and 10 walks.

Dodgers taken deep

Saddled with 10 no-decisions this season, Randy Wolf might have liked another one. Instead, the left-hander allowed five runs on three homers in just 3 1/3 innings. In all, Dodgers pitchers surrendered six long balls, the most homers allowed by the team in one game in almost eight years.

Six for Sox

The White Sox kept the fireworks operator at U.S. Cellular Field mighty busy, blasting six home runs, one shy of the team record. Josh Fields hit two, including one of three in the fifth inning. Alexei Ramirez, Jermaine Dye, Paul Konerko and Jayson Nix also tallied homers.
